Does anyone know why they are giving this error to my model?
 
This error does not appear in browedit, only when you log in to the game.
 
Problem in texture? I've already reviewed the entire texture, and I can not figure it out.
 
Sure this problem comes from texture, or mapping ... but ... how to solve this?
 
I'm using browedit 620

Hi the error is by overlapping vertex. The surface of your model is not flat, a face or a triangle of the model is overcoming that surface.

In browedit looks okay because it renders different than in Ragnarok.

Means you must fix the model in 3d software. Maybe you can upload the model to see if we can help.

Edit: and by flat I mean, that vertex is not joining the others by the exact x,y,z coordinates to make a flat surface.
